2016年3月25日 星期五

3.25 Linux桌面系統 上課心得


1. Linux Foundation的目標為何?
2. Linux Foundation 辦過那些活動?
3. Linux Foundation 建議那些 Linux 發行版?
4. Linux 核心的作者是誰?什麼時候開始撰寫?
5. Linux 社群採用何種通溝管道?
6. 解釋名詞:命令列 Command Line、桌面環境 Desktop Enviroment、核心 Kernel、FHS
7. 試述 Linux 的啟動程序
8. 選定 Linux 發行版時,應考慮的事項?
9. Linux 有幾個介面?
10. Linux 有那些圖形介面?您使用的是什麼 ?
11. 您的 Linux 採用什麼軟體為其預設編輯器?
12. 在您的 Home Directory 內,有那些預設的資料夾?
13. 如何設定系統時間/日期?
14. 您用過那些上網方式?

3.25 開放資料 上課心得

開放源代碼:開放商的權利,軟體須符合

      1.自由再散佈

該軟體的授權,應同意將該軟體可以置於其他的系統中銷售或贈送,不能有任何限制;不應從其銷售中要求任何費用。 

      2.原始碼

這個程式必須提供原始碼,且必須允許可以散佈原始碼或是編譯後的執行碼。沒有附原始碼的產品,必須以眾所皆知的方法提供原始碼,收取合理的複製費用,經由網際網路下載則不能收費。原始碼必須包裝成程式設計師可以修改的格式,不允許故意混淆原始碼,也不允許提供經由前置處理器或翻譯器編譯過的中繼程式。 
      3.衍生作品
這個授權書必需同意修改及衍生原作品, 且必須同意以原軟體授權書相同的條件散佈衍生作品。
      4.完整性
為了在安裝階段修改原始程式,在同意把"補丁"檔和原始碼同時散布的前提下,才能夠限制修改原始碼。授權書必須清楚地允許散布軟體修改後的原始碼;可以要求散布衍生作品時,以不同於原軟體的名稱或版本編號。 
      5. 不能歧視任何人或團體
授權書不能歧視任何人或團體。
      6. 不歧視任何領域的努力
授權書不能限制任何人在特定領域使用軟體。例如,不能限制特定公司或基因研究產業使用該程式。
      7. 散佈許可證
附屬於程式的權利必須適用於所有再散布的程式,不需要任何單位的再授權。 
      8. 授權書不能針對某個產品
附屬於程式的權利不能祗適用於含蓋該程式的特定軟體版本。從特定軟體抽取出來的程式,以該程式之名使用或散布時,再散布程式的授權書應擁有與原軟體版本相同的權利。 
      9. 授權書不能限制其他的軟體
授權書不能限制同時散布的其他軟體;如:此授權書不能要求在同個載體上散布的其他程式,必須是開放源碼軟體。 
      10. 授權書必須技術中立 
授權書的內容不能以任何個別技術或介面為基準。 
授權書的內容,符合上述定義,並經由一定程序,就可以被開放源碼組織認可為開放源碼的授權書(OSL, 2006): 

自由軟體:使用者的權利,賦予使用者自由

  • 自由之零:不論目的為何,有使用該軟體的自由。
  • 自由之一:有研究該軟體如何運作的自由,並且得以修改該軟體來符合使用者自身的需求。取得該軟體之源碼為達成此目的之前提。
  • 自由之二:有重新散布該軟體的自由,所以每個人都可以藉由散布自由軟體來敦親睦鄰。
  • 自由之三:有改善再利用該軟體的自由,並且可以發表修訂後的版本供公眾使用,如此一來,整個社群都可以受惠。如前項,取得該軟體之源碼為達成此目的之前提。

檔案格式需公開

常見軟體授權條款:

  • GPL(GNU General Public license)
創用CC (Creative Commons)




2016年3月18日 星期五

3.18 Linux桌面系統 上課心得

Mounting Parameters 裝載參數
/media   



在重灌電腦電腦的過程中
意外的Winddow在Grub中無法顯示
而找了一些網站資料來看
grub恢复win8的引导!
Install Ubuntu 14.04 alongside Windows 8.1 in 10 easy steps

3.18 開放資料 上課心得


古騰堡計畫


古騰堡計畫的目標是:

  1. 為社會大眾製作及散布電子文本。
  2. 所有的人都能接受, 不受價格及取用性(硬體及軟體)的限制, 電子文本沒有任何標價。
  3. 立即可用的電子文本, 不需額外的調整, 可被人眼及電腦程式讀取, 甚至比紙本還受歡迎。
  4. 每年倍增電子文本。
收錄的作品有三類:

  1. 休閒文學 - 愛麗絲夢遊仙境等
  2. 經典文學 - 莎士比亞, 白鯨記, 失樂園等
  3. 參考工具書 - Roget的辭語典等
20世紀初期興起的公共圖書館運動, 有效的散布公共文學及文化遺產, 古騰堡計畫也有相同的情懷, 以「打破無知與文盲的阻礙」為其口號。因此, 所有的作品都以純文字檔呈現(Plain ASCII), 避過PDF等臃腫的其他格式。

公版作品
可以被任何人基於任何目的自由地研究、應用、複製與修改的著作或表達。 為了尊重與保障這些自由,另外提出若干限制。自由授權係用來保障自由著作,公眾關心的是自由著作範圍,而不是自由授權的內容。

科技讓每個人可以擁有每個事物, 但是法律禁止我們這麼做。


著作權法

2016年3月11日 星期五

3.11 Linux桌面系統 上課心得

The Linux Foundation is a nonprofit organization that sponsors the work of Linux creator
Linus Torvalds

Linux Foundation Events:
  • Provide an open forum for development of the next kernel (the actual operating system) release.
  • Bring together developers and system administrators to solve problems in a real-time environment.
  • Host workgroups and community groups for active discussions.
  • Connect end users, system administrators, and kernel developers in order to grow Linux use in the enterprise.
  • Encourage collaboration among the entire community.
  • Provide an atmosphere that is unmatched in its ability to further the platform.
distribution (發行版):

  1. Debian Family Systems (such as Ubuntu)
  2. SUSE Family Systems (such as openSUSE)
  3. Fedora Family Systems (such as CentOS)

Embedded Linux 嵌入式Linux作業系統
被廣泛地使用在行動電話、媒體播放器以及眾多消費性電子裝置中,如Android, Tizen
優點:開放原始碼、所需容量小、不需版權費、成熟與穩定、良好的支援



文字編輯器:

  • nano, a simple text-based editor.
  • gedit, a simple graphical editor
  • vi and emacs, two advanced editors with both text-based and graphical interfaces.

3.11 開放資料 上課心得

沒有受限的自由就不是自由

自由著作本身還是要經過授權的

自由文化著作,討論的是數位的表現形式


  • 開放定義:當知識是任何人都可以自由存取、使用、修改,以及分享,且最多僅受限於註引出處及保持開放的尺度時,它才是開放的。
  • 著作受著作權法的保障,但著作人可以選擇用什麼樣的授權方式讓使用者使用,著作人仍然保有對於該著作的權利


著作人可以在著作上標示自由文化著作,即是授權其他人可以使用
以下是自由文化著作授權的內容

  • 使用及表演著作的自由:必須允許被授權人私下或公開任意使用著作,在條件適用的情況下,包括表演或解析著作等衍生使用(相關使用)自由,不受政治及宗教的影響。
  • 研析著作與應用資訊的自由:必須允許被授權人檢視著作與使用獲得的知識,授權不可限制「逆向工程」之類的情事。
  • 再散布複本的自由:把複本置於較大著作內、收錄在合集之內或單獨出售、交換或贈送,都含在授權之內。不能限制複本的數量、複製者及發送地點。
  • 散布衍生著作的自由:為了讓每個人都有改進著作的機會,不論其意圖與目的為何,都不能限制散布修訂版(或,衍生自原著的類比著作)的自由。即使有些限制,也僅限於保護這些基本的自由權利或姓名標示權
當然,著作人還是可以對它有額外的限制,此稱為著佐權